Not Envying

1

As 'strict decorum's' laws, that all men bind,

Let each regard unenvying grace of mind.

Meanings :-

Let a man esteem that disposition which is free from envy in the same manner as propriety of conduct.

**********************************************************************

2

If man can learn to envy none on earth,

'Tis richest gift, -beyond compare its worth.

Meanings :-

Amongst all attainable excellences there is none equal to that of being free from envy towords others.

**********************************************************************

3

Nor wealth nor virtue does that man desire 'tis plain,

Whom others' wealth delights not, feeling envious pain.

Meanings :-

Of him who instead of rejoicing in the wealth of others, envies it, it will be said "he neither desires virtue not wealth."

**********************************************************************

4

The wise through envy break not virtue's laws,

Knowing ill-deeds of foul disgrace the cause.

Meanings :-

(The wise) knowing the misery that comes from transgression will not through envy commit unrighteous deeds.

**********************************************************************

5

Envy they have within! Enough to seat their fate!

Though foemen fail, envy can ruin consummate.

Meanings :-

To those who cherish envy that is enough. Though free from enemies that (envy) will bring destruction.

**********************************************************************

6

Who scans good gifts to others given with envious eye,

His kin, with none to clothe or feed them, surely die.

Meanings :-

He who is envious at a gift (made to another) will with his relations utterly perish destitute of food and rainment.

**********************************************************************

7

From envious man good fortune's goddess turns away,

Grudging him good, and points him out misfortune's prey.

Meanings :-

Lakshmi envying (the prosperity) of the envious man will depart and introduce him to her sister.

**********************************************************************

8

Envy, embodied ill, incomparable bane,

Good fortune slays, and soul consigns to fiery pain.

Meanings :-

Envy will destroy (a man's) wealth (in his world) and drive him into the pit of fire (in the world to come.)

**********************************************************************

9

To men of envious heart, when comes increase of joy,

Or loss to blameless men, the 'why' will thoughtful hearts employ.

Meanings :-

The wealth of a man of envious mind and the poverty of the righteous will be pondered.

**********************************************************************

10

No envious men to large and full felicity attain;

No men from envy free have failed a sure increase to gain.

Meanings :-

Never have the envious become great; never have those who are free from envy been without greatness.
